This problem could be solved using the Law of Cosines, since we are given with the three sides. The equation goes,
b^2 = a^2 + c^2 - 2accosB. Substituting,
24^2 = 7^2 + 25^2 - 2(7)(25)cosB
Then B = 73.7 degrees. Therefore sinB or sin(73.7) = 0.96.

If A and B are supplementary angles, then:
A+B=180º
In this case:
A=44º
44º+B=180º
B=180º-44º=136º
Anser: the measure of the other angle is 136º
